Instagram logo

Real Carrier Phone Number for Instagram Verification

Real carrier numbers — what's often sold as “non-VoIP numbers” — that pass Instagram's VoIP detection, guaranteed or refunded.

$1.80 one-time · 20-minute window · Instant delivery

Real carrier numbersLicensed carrier infrastructure143 services supported

Why Instagram Rejects VoIP Numbers

Social media platforms integrate commercial carrier-lookup APIs — services from providers like Twilio Lookup and similar tools — to score every phone number that touches their verification flow. These lookup APIs return a risk score based on the number's origin: real carrier, VoIP, prepaid, landline, or shared pool. VoIP and shared virtual numbers consistently score as "high risk" because they're the primary tool used to create bot accounts at scale.

When Instagram processes your verification request, that carrier-lookup check happens in milliseconds. A VoIP number gets flagged and rejected — often with the message "This number cannot be used for verification" — before an SMS is even sent. There is no workaround for a rejection at this layer; the platform has made a policy decision based on the number's carrier type.

Real carrier numbers, provisioned through licensed US carrier infrastructure, return a "low risk" carrier score. They look like ordinary mobile numbers because, technically, they are. Instagram's verification flow sees no reason to reject them. ReverbSMS rents you one of these genuine carrier numbers for a 20-minute window — enough time to complete verification and move on.

Instagram's phone verification layer uses commercial carrier-lookup APIs that score every number at the point of submission — VoIP and shared virtual numbers score as high-risk and are blocked before a code is sent, often with no explanation.

How to Verify Your Instagram Account with ReverbSMS

Step 1

Add credits

Add credits to your account ($5 minimum). Credits never expire.

Step 2

Rent a Instagram number

Select the service and rent a number — 20-minute window or long-term.

Step 3

Receive your code

Enter the number in Instagram and receive the code in your ReverbSMS inbox.

Instagram Verification Pricing

$1.80one-time
  • 20-minute rental window
  • Real US carrier number
  • Full credit refund if no code arrives
  • Reusable 7-day, 30-day & 90-day plans available

Credits never expire. Buy once, use whenever. See all plans →

Frequently Asked Questions About Instagram SMS Verification

This Instagram error typically means the number failed a carrier-type check, not that the number is personally blocked. Instagram uses carrier-lookup scoring to filter VoIP and virtual numbers at scale — these numbers score as high-risk because they're the standard tool for bot account creation. Switching to a real carrier number, which scores as low-risk, resolves this. ReverbSMS provides genuine carrier numbers that pass Instagram's carrier score check.

Other Social Services We Support

Ready to verify your Instagram account?

No subscription required. Credits never expire.

Get My Instagram Number →